One of the most exciting advancements that the country has embraced is Blockchain vehicle-to-grid (V2G) technology, a game-changing system that allows electric vehicles to not only consume electricity but also to return excess energy back to the grid. Blockchain V2G technology enables electric vehicles to communicate with the power grid through a secure and decentralized network. This two-way communication system facilitates real-time energy trading, balancing supply and demand, and promoting renewable energy integration. By leveraging the power of blockchain technology, Argentina is ushering in a new era of energy distribution that is more efficient, sustainable, and cost-effective. One of the key benefits of blockchain V2G technology is its ability to optimize energy usage and reduce costs for both consumers and utility companies. Electric vehicle owners can earn money by selling excess energy stored in their vehicles' batteries back to the grid during peak demand periods. This not only helps to stabilize the grid but also incentivizes the adoption of electric vehicles. Furthermore, blockchain V2G technology plays a crucial role in promoting renewable energy sources, such as solar and wind power. By allowing electric vehicles to store and supply renewable energy to the grid, Argentina is reducing its reliance on fossil fuels and making significant strides towards a cleaner and more sustainable energy future. Moreover, the decentralized nature of blockchain technology ensures the security and integrity of energy transactions, eliminating the need for intermediaries and reducing the risk of fraud or manipulation. This transparency and trustworthiness are essential for fostering a thriving energy marketplace based on fairness and accountability.
